Job description

About The Role

As a Process Technologist you will make sure that new products can be made safely, legally and to the right quality. You will run factory trials, follow the critical path and help products move from kitchen concept to full launch. If you would love to see a product on a shelf and think that you played a key role in making that happen, this is a great role for you!

Key Responsibilities:
  • Follow the critical path to launch new products on time.
  • Run bakery or factory trials and make sure products work on the line.
  • Gather key information such as microbiological, nutritional and sensory data.
  • Ensure products meet food safety, legality and quality standards.
  • Check new raw materials and raise concerns through HACCP if needed.
  • Approve packaging artwork before launch.
About You

We believe success comes from collaboration and diverse perspectives. At Samworth Brothers, we value team players who are driven to achieve great results together. You’ll bring the following skills and experience:

  • Food industry or technical experience is helpful; graduates with Food Science are also welcome to apply.
  • Experience in chilled manufacturing or FMCG is an advantage.
  • Comfortable running or supporting factory trials.
  • Understanding of HACCP, specs, raw materials and quality processes.
  • Experience in cross-functional roles such as NPD, Technical or Production is useful.

About Us

Samworth Brothers is a fourth-generation family business, trusted by many of the UK’s best-known retailers to produce high-quality own-label products. Alongside these, we’re proud to craft and deliver our own iconic brands, including Ginsters, Soreen, Higgidy, Dickinson & Morris, Urban Eat, West Cornwall Pasty Company, and Walker & Son.

With over 10,000 talented colleagues working across our modern, well-invested food manufacturing sites nationwide, we’re committed to excellence in everything we do—from the food we make to the careers we build.
